The information Sylvia has posted for you is from the LDS (Mormon) site and using the batch and film nos from it, you can order the film of the original register to view at a LDS Family History Centre. This site:
http://www.familysearch.org/eng/library/fhc/frameset_fhc.asp
will help you find one.
